4-H Club Divisions

Utah 4-H Age Divisions are based on a child's school grade.  Youth are eligible to participate in 4-H between Kindergarten and 12th Grade.  Youth who are homeschooled will follow the Utah State Board of Education criteria for placement based on age.  

  • Cloverbud 4-H members Kindergarten through 2nd grade (Ages 5 through 7 as of September 1).
  • Junior 4-H Members 3rd through 5th grade (Ages 8 through 10 as of September 1).
  • Intermediate 4-H Members 6th through 8th grade (Ages 11 thorugh 13 as of September 1).
  • Senior 4-H Members 9th through 12th grade ( Ages 14 through 18 as of September 1). 
Info! *Large animal, shooting sports, and ATV projects and activities require youth to be at least in 3rd grade and at least 8 years of age.  Youth in the 3rd grade who are 7 years old and turn 8 during the third-grade school year may enroll in large animal, shooting sports,and ATV projects upon turning 8.  Eligibility for 4-H membership terminates upon graduation from 12th grade.  Seniors may exhibit through the summer of their graduation year.
